WebPrimary KEY is more of a logical thing, however Primary INDEX is more of physical thing. In Teradata, Primary INDEX is used for finding best access path for data retrieval and …

WebDec 6, 2024 · By introduction, I would like to point out that the Teradata primary index should not be confused with a primary key. The primary index is only used to distribute the data evenly across all AMPs. Often the primary index will be equal to the primary key because it has primary key properties that often make it appear optimal as a primary … WebOct 31, 2024 · TableName - name of table. WebSep 24, 2015 · As the name suggests, No primary index table means there will be no primary index defined on Teradata table. This feature has been introduced in V2R13 release. The main purpose of this feature which allows us to create tables with no primary index in Teradata is to improve the performance of FastLoad and Tpump array insert …

WebSep 8, 2024 · Teradata may send all rows to the same AMP and one data block. AMP-local copying of the rows will be applied when executing an “INSERT…SELECT” statement from a primary index table into a NOPI table. All rows stay on their current AMP, and if the primary index table is skewed, the NOPI table will be skewed.
